Enka sells retail business in Russia to France's Auchan
New Anatolian, Turkey -Dec 20, 2007
Privately owned French retailer Auchan said it has agreed to buy 14 hypermarkets in Russia from Turkish group Enka. Auchan did not disclose financial terms

Covidien to sell retail business for $335M
Bizjournals.com, NC -Dec 17, 2007
Medical devices firm Covidien Ltd. plans to sell its retail products business to First Quality Enterprises Inc. for $335 million, the companies report.
